In 2021-2022, 1,070 people earned their degree in construction/heavy equipment/earthmoving equipment operation, making the major the 919th most popular in the United States.
Across Arizona, there were 22 construction/heavy equipment/earthmoving equipment operation gra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 7 construction/heavy equipment/earthmoving equipment operation gra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,722 and $16,974 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Central Arizona College.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Schools for an Associate Highly Focused on Construction/Heavy Equipment/Earthmoving Equipment Operation Major in Arizona list. Pinal County Community College is located in Coolidge, Arizona and, has a small student population. In 2021-2022, this school awarded 7 associates’s construction/heavy equipment/earthmoving equipment operation degrees to qualified students.
The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 0.8%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
